Discussions on WindowsForum.com about converting HTML to PDF often center on security vulnerabilities in Microsoft 365's PDF export feature. A critical flaw, earning a $3,000 bounty from Microsoft's Security Response Center, exposed a Local File Inclusion attack vector that could compromise sensitive enterprise data across multi-tenant environments. This highlights the importance of patching and secure PDF generation practices.
